The feeling of freedom and excitement is what draws many people to motorcycling. This is exactly why so many motorcyclists prefer riding a motorcycle than driving a limiting car. Then again, thanks to this freedom, you don’t have the type of safety and protection that comes with driving an enclosed car. As with any kind of driving, it is possible to reduce any danger through taking precautions and here are some tips that can help you.
For those who drive a car, what you put on is pretty much elective but this is not the case with motorcycling. A decent helmet and leathers are crucial and potentially can save your life. You need to conduct proper research to ensure a comfortable not to mention safe ride. It is fortunate that in these days of the online world, it is possible to quickly seek information and in the end only you can be the judge of what is right for you.
One of the most significant aspects of driving a motorbike is to be seen in all conditions. Many car drivers tend not to pay too much attention to bikers. Even so, this is basically a two way thing and just as many car drivers haven’t ever ridden a motorbike, it is also the case than many bikers have never been behind the wheel of a car. That’s the reason it is best to drive defensively as an effective motorcyclist. It might be safer to imagine that a car driver hasn’t seen you rather than speed past a road junction assuming they have.
In addition to your motorcycling skills, you need to pay close attention to your motorbike. The older your bike gets, the more important it is to keep it well maintained. Many devotees love to tinker with this by themselves but there are times when you need to call on the services of an expert. This is especially true with regards to your brakes so that your machine is going to be ready in any situation.
As being a motorcyclist, you generally want to try to test the speed and precision of your bike. Additionally, there are riders that like to travel together and this can also mean there is a temptation to showcase your skills. Safety ought to always be a leading priority even when you just want to have fun riding. With proper upkeep of your machine and riding defensively, you will be able to ride your bike for many years.
